Does anyone have experience with replacing the lower oil pan? I wasted 2 hours tring to pry it off but the sealent is keeping it from moving. Really don't want to tow it to the dealership who quoted over $1K just for labor.

If you have all the bolts out, use a flat head screwdriver, and get it inbetween the pan and the tranny, and take a rubber mallet and smack the screwdriver. This will create a space between the pan and the tranny. Do this on each side (not on the corners) and then you should be able to pry it off with a little more ease.
